=head1 NAME
browser-tests - Run Cypress browser tests, set up for FixMyStreet.
=head1 SYNOPSIS
browser-tests [running options] [fixture options] [cypress options]
Running options:
--config provide an override general.yml file
--server only run the test server, not cypress
--cypress only run cypress, not the test server
--vagrant run test server inside Vagrant, cypress outside
--wsl provide path to cypress node script, to run test server inside WSL, cypress outside
--help this help message
Fixture option:
--cobrand Cobrand(s) to use, default is fixmystreet,northamptonshire,bathnes,buckinghamshire,isleofwight,peterborough,tfl,hackney,oxfordshire
--coords Default co-ordinates for created reports
--area_id Area ID to use for created body
--name Name to use for created body
--mapit_url MapIt URL to use, default mock
Use browser-tests instead of running cypress directly, so that a clean
database is set up for Cypress to use, not affecting your normal dev database.
If you're running FixMyStreet in a VM, you can use this script to run the test
server in the VM and Cypress outside of it.
$ browser-tests open # to run interactively
$ browser-tests run # run headlessly
$ browser-tests run --record --key # record and upload a run
$ browser-tests --vagrant run # run if you use Vagrant
$ browser-tests --wsl ..cypress run # run if you use WSL
You need to have installed cypress already using npm, and it needs to be on
your PATH.
